"Keep-a-copy" mailet
Hello:
Is there a mailet that will keep a copy of an incoming mail in a
designated repository or the deadletter repository, while still delivering
the mail as normal? My purpose being that I would like to keep raw
e-mails for spam "forensics", but my James server is 99% used for relaying
mail into another internal server. Very little mail stays in inboxes on
the machine.
